I really like the idea of a #ContributionGraph or some means of tagging and associating dois that goes beyond citation maps. For the very reason that citations are prone to various unintended biases that accumulate over time rather than self correct (winner-take-all mech. but for publications). Going #offtopic again sry -- I feel that we need to start building a better #ContributionGraph so that no one's contributions get left behind. It is something some of us at #neuromatchstodon have discussed building. I imagine the graph to be like a bit like neurotree for #neuroscience but where research areas could be the nodes and researchers can add their own contributions in the tree where they think their work fits, potentially often connecting different research nodes. And ofc we can expand this to all forms of contributions within #academia and #science
